Sustainable Energy for All (SEforALL) is an international organization that works in partnership with the United Nations and leaders in government, the private sector, financial institutions, civil society and philanthropies to drive faster action towards the achievement of Sustainable Development Goal 7 (SDG7) – access to affordable, reliable, sustainable and modern energy for all by 2030 – in line with the Paris Agreement on climate. Former UN Secretary-General Ban Ki-moon launched the Sustainable Energy for All initiative in 2011. Now an independent organization, SEforALL works to ensure a clean energy transition that leaves no one behind and brings new opportunities for everyone to fulfill their potential, with SEforALL's CEO Damilola Ogunbiyi acting as the UN Secretary-General's Special Representative for Sustainable Energy for All and Co-Chair of UN-Energy. Our staff is based at our headquarters in Vienna, Austria and at our satellite office in Washington, DC in the United States. Governance is provided by the SEforALL Administrative Board. 🌍💡 Lagos State faces a significant energy challenge, relying on over 4.5 million fossil fuel generators, emitting 39 million tonnes of CO2 annually. SEforALL, in partnership with the Lagos State Government, has conducted a comprehensive study to address this issue by collecting precise data on generator usage. This study will guide efforts to transition to cleaner energy alternatives, aligning with #Nigeria's ambitious energy goals of universal access by 2030 and net-zero emissions by 2060. 📢 Exciting news from the sidelines of #UNGA79 in New York! The Africa Minerals Strategy Group (AMSG), led by Secretary General H.E. Moses Engadu, announced it will be joining the Council for Critical Minerals Development in the Global South. This initiative, backed by SEforALL, the Institute of Transportation Studies at the University of California, Davis, and Swaniti Global, aims to leverage Africa’s critical minerals to strengthen local value chains for energy transition technologies, create jobs, and support industrialization across the continent. 🌍🔋 Together, we’re driving collaboration and ensuring equitable development of mineral resources for the global energy transition.
